Art is not just something that hangs in galleries or sits behind glass cases in museums. True art lives in our hands, in the quiet moments when we create, mold, weave, or paint something that carries a part of our soul. Every handmade object—whether it is a clay vase, a crochet bag, or a painted canvas—is more than a product. It is a story, a memory, and an emotion captured in form.

When you hold a handmade item, you are not just holding an object. You are holding time, patience, and love. A potter’s hands shape the earth into vessels that carry both beauty and utility. A weaver’s fingers move rhythmically, creating patterns that generations have cherished. A crocheted piece tells the story of hours spent looping, knotting, and perfecting every detail. Each touch, each imperfection, is what makes handmade art truly priceless.

In today’s fast-moving world of machines and mass production, handmade art reminds us of the value of slowness and care. It connects us to tradition while allowing space for personal expression. Every creator leaves a part of themselves in their work, making handmade art feel alive, personal, and deeply human.

Owning or gifting handmade creations is not just about buying—it is about supporting an artist’s journey, appreciating craftsmanship, and celebrating individuality. When you choose handmade, you choose authenticity over uniformity, passion over machinery, and story over silence.

Indeed, art is not only what you see—it is what you can hold, cherish, and pass on. Art is in your hands, waiting to be touched, loved, and remembered.
